Fortune 500? Partners List (as of July 24, 2017)

This list represents Green Power Partners that also appear on the Fortune 500? list. EPA's list of Fortune 500 Partners consists of 81 companies using nearly 21 billion kilowatt-hours (kWh) of green power annually, which is equivalent to the electricity use of nearly 1.9 million average American homes.
